Tel Aviv, Israel, often referred to as the "White City," is a vibrant and cosmopolitan metropolis that serves as a melting pot of cultures, ideologies, and artistic expressions. The city's rich history, dynamic present, and hopeful future have inspired numerous authors to capture its essence in their works. From acclaimed novelists like Amos Oz and David Grossman to emerging voices in Hebrew literature, Tel Aviv is a hub for thought-provoking stories that explore complex themes such as identity, politics, and human relationships. One can meander through the bustling streets of Tel Aviv and stumble upon charming bookshops, independent publishing houses, and literary events that showcase the diverse voices shaping Israel's literary landscape. Whether you're interested in contemporary fiction, historical narratives, or poetry that captures the complexities of modern Israeli society, Tel Aviv has something for every bookworm to explore and enjoy.
